Warning: file_get_contents(/data/phpspider/zhask/data//catemap/4/jquery-ui/2.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
Jquery ui 如何将textarea合并到Jquery对话框中_Jquery Ui_Textarea_Modal Dialog - Fatal编程技术网

Jquery ui 如何将textarea合并到Jquery对话框中

Jquery ui 如何将textarea合并到Jquery对话框中,jquery-ui,textarea,modal-dialog,Jquery Ui,Textarea,Modal Dialog,我试图在JQuery对话框中插入一个textarea,但我对如何设置我必须使用的对话框的语法很感兴趣(顺便说一下,我没有编写对话框,我只是想对它进行更改)。我在这个网站上看到了一些类似的问题,但它们似乎没有回答我的问题,所以我希望有人能为我解释一下 代码如下: $('.rejection_toggle').button().click(function(event) { var $dialog = $('<div />', { text: Drupal.t('Are you

我试图在JQuery对话框中插入一个textarea,但我对如何设置我必须使用的对话框的语法很感兴趣(顺便说一下,我没有编写对话框,我只是想对它进行更改)。我在这个网站上看到了一些类似的问题,但它们似乎没有回答我的问题,所以我希望有人能为我解释一下

代码如下:

$('.rejection_toggle').button().click(function(event) {
 var $dialog = $('<div />', {
   text: Drupal.t('Are you sure you want to reject this form? If so, then please leave a comment as to why you are rejecting it.')
    })
 var $button = $(this);
 $('body').append($dialog);
 $dialog.dialog({
  title: Drupal.t('Reject this form?'),
  buttons: {
      'Reject': function (event) {
        var $submitID = $button.attr('id').replace('rejection-toggle', 'approval-buttons-reject'),
        $submitButton = $('#' + $submitID);

        $submitButton.click();
        $dialog.dialog('close');
      },
      'Cancel': function (event) {
        $dialog.dialog('close');
      }
    }
  });
  return false;
});
$('.rejection\u toggle')。按钮()。单击(函数(事件){
变量$dialog=$(''{
text:Drupal.t('您确定要拒绝此表单吗?如果是,请留下评论,说明拒绝此表单的原因。')
})
var$按钮=$(此按钮);
$('body')。追加($dialog);
$dialog.dialog({
标题:Drupal.t('拒绝此表单?'),
按钮:{
“拒绝”:函数(事件){
var$submitID=$button.attr('id')。replace('rejection-toggle','approval buttons reject'),
$submitButton=$(“#”+$submitID);
$submitButton.click();
$dialog.dialog('close');
},
“取消”:函数(事件){
$dialog.dialog('close');
}
}
});
返回false;
});
那么,我该如何在按钮前插入文本区域呢


谢谢。

好的,我知道了。我需要补充:

var textArea = $('<textarea style="width:100%" />'); 
$dialog.append(textArea);
var textArea=$('');
$dialog.append(textArea);
在var$对话框行之后

现在我需要弄清楚如何将输入返回到Drupal中